Witryna27 lut 2024 · At the time of vaginal delivery, the risk of herpes simplex virus transmission from a mother with true primary herpes simplex virus infection to her infant is approximately 50%. Women with primary infections at delivery are 10-30 times more likely than women with a recurrent infection to transmit the virus to their babies. Witryna21 lis 2015 · Roseola, also called exanthem subitum and sixth disease, is a common, contagious viral infection caused by the human herpesvirus (HHV) 6. This strain of the herpes virus is different than the one that causes cold sores or genital herpes infections. Roseola occurs most often in children aged 6 to 24 months.
